About Us Sidney Health Center is a not-for-profit community based medical center that has been serving people in the MonDak region for more than 100 years. Our passion for caring is shared by doctors, nurses and over 500 employees and volunteers. This commitment to caring is our allegiance to the community as we strive to provide Exceptional Care for Life while offering many services that are rarely found in like-size communities. From state-of-the-art imaging services to cancer care to a locally-owned air ambulance service, Sidney Health Center combines the modern medical amenities with a small-town agriculture-based community. Requirements

  • Graduate from an accredited school of Nursing
  • Knowledge of general nursing theory and practice
  • Current Montana license as a RN or current temporary license or Current Montana license as a LPN
  • BLS
  • ACLS
